Output a26a969af9882b440f5239c622ca255354a1f526a8c98a70463f9382a107dace:0

value
677018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2ac635e1a12e8bde29dc6b327fa5b392103adda OP_EQUAL
address
3LtxLZr1Xez3Yc9Yqac7fVJnE2P5vdgkLH
transaction
a26a969af9882b440f5239c622ca255354a1f526a8c98a70463f9382a107dace
confirmations
318224
spent
true